Local regulations

Argentina

Licensing:

  • combined — residents A recreational fishing permit (permiso/licencia de pesca deportiva) is issued PER PROVINCE — there is no single national licence. You must hold the licence of the province where you fish, and rules (bag limits, size limits, closed seasons / vedas) vary by province. Inland Patagonian fishing is covered by a regional Reglamento de Pesca Deportiva Continental Patagónico; the Buenos Aires province requires a permit under Ley de Pesca Nº 11.477 (art. 21), including a "Costera Menor Marítima" licence for marine-coastal angling. Confirm the correct authority for your location before fishing., non-residents Visiting anglers must obtain the recreational licence of the province where they intend to fish (most provinces, including Buenos Aires and the Patagonian provinces, offer online/tourist licences). A licence from one province is not valid in another. Buy the correct provincial licence before fishing.
